i leave in a week for a month of training in Thailand. i am staying at Tiger Muay Thai in Phuket. 1 month of traing and room cost $500 US. My flight cost $1300 US from NYC.
I would also suggest looking at Fairtex and Jitti. I heard good things about both. Fairtex was a little pricey for me though. good luck.
